Site Set Up volunteers work as a team to create a safe and inspiring course room for the 3-day retreat kick-off ti the Y-NOW Program. This requires volunteers to perform a variety of tasks including: packing and unloading supplies from Safe Place Services' vans, setting up sound system, hanging posters, setting up logistics rooms, moving items in and out of the course room as necessary, etc.
Volunteers meet at Safe Place Services (2400 Crittenden Dr) then drive themselves or carpool to the retreat site: Country Lake Christian Retreat Center in Underwood, IN (which is about 20 minutes north of Louisville).

Mission Statement
Y-NOW Mentoring Program aims to break the cycle of incarceration seen by youth with incarcerated parents. It fulfills this mission by promoting Positive Youth Development among young people with incarcerated parents. Y-NOW does this by cultivating healthy youth-adult relationships in a safe community.
Description
Y-NOW, formerly known as Project N.O.W. (New Outlook Within), is the mentoring component of the YMCA Safe Place Services branch in Louisville, KY. Since 1996, Y-NOW has been delivering unique, intensive mentoring programs for young people in Louisville. Y-NOW delivers a mentoring program designed for youth ages 11-15 with parents affected by incarceration or substance abuse. Our primary outcomes address academic achievement, youth empowerment, and breaking the cycle of incarceration and substance abuse.
